Output 7880696d2c64f640b1776bcab6a682b863cdb325c221ad0584f180aa38ba499b:0

value
492560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10150dfce1af0d27cc10bb4bb1833a9f96edc449 OP_EQUALVERIFY OP_CHECKSIG
address
12U32yLW7rna7xPXqwGoHPCh1TqbC7uU5S
transaction
7880696d2c64f640b1776bcab6a682b863cdb325c221ad0584f180aa38ba499b
spent
true